爬虫与机器学习:9个应用案例介绍
优采云 发布时间: 2023-05-07 20:59机器学习和爬虫技术是当今互联网时代的两大热门话题。机器学习为人工智能的发展提供了强有力的支持,而爬虫技术则为网络数据的获取提供了便利。本文将从以下9个方面,详细介绍机器学习与爬虫技术的应用。
一、机器学习的定义及应用
机器学习是一种基于数据分析的人工智能技术,它可以通过不断地学习和优化模型,来实*敏*感*词*融、医疗、电商等行业也有着越来越多的应用场景。
二、爬虫技术的定义及应用
爬虫技术是一种自动化获取网页信息的技术。通过程序模拟浏览器行为,自动抓取网页内容并解析,从而实现对数据的采集和整合。爬虫技术在舆情监测、搜索引擎优化(SEO)、竞品分析等方面有着广泛的应用。
三、机器学习与爬虫技术的结合
机器学习和爬虫技术的结合,可以实现对*敏*感*词*数据的智能分析和挖掘。例如,利用爬虫技术获取网络上的商品信息,然后通过机器学习算法对价格趋势、销量预测等进行分析,从而帮助电商企业做出更加科学的决策。
四、利用爬虫技术获取数据源
在使用机器学习算法进行数据分析前,需要先获取大量的数据源。这时候,爬虫技术就派上用场了。例如,通过爬虫技术获取社交媒体上用户的评论信息、微博上用户的转发信息等,从而构建一个庞大的数据集。
五、数据清洗与预处理
由于网络上的数据存在着各种各样的问题,如缺失值、异常值等,因此在进行机器学习前需要对数据进行清洗和预处理。例如,在对房价进行预测时,需要将房价数据中存在的异常值进行过滤。
六、特征工程
特征工程是指将原始数据转换成适合机器学习算法输入的特征表示的过程。在特征工程中,需要对数据进行特征提取、特征变换等操作。例如,在对用户进行性别分类时,可以通过用户的头像特征、昵称等信息进行特征提取。
七、选择合适的机器学习算法
在进行机器学习时,需要根据实际问题选择合适的机器学习算法。例如,在对用户进行情感分析时,可以使用SVM、决策树等算法。
八、模型评估与优化
在完成模型训练后,需要对模型进行评估和优化。例如,在对股票价格进行预测时,可以通过平均绝对误差(MAE)、均方误差(MSE)等指标来评估模型的准确度,并通过调整模型参数来提高预测准确度。
九、结语
机器学习与爬虫技术的结合,为企业提供了更加便捷和高效的数据分析方式。但是,在应用这些技术时,也需要注意数据安全和隐私保护问题。希望本文能够为读者提供一些有用的参考信息。
以上内容摘自优采云(www.ucaiyun.com),一家致力于为企业提供SEO优化和数据分析服务的互联网公司。